  • Winemaker: Noah and Kelly Dorrance of Reeve Wines
  • Farming: Sustainable 
  • Varieties: Pinot Noir
  • Terroir: Utilizing different fruit sources mostly throughout Sonoma County, primarily on Goldridge sandy loam and clay.
  • Fermentation: 15% whole cluster fermentation, pressed in Coquard basket press, the wine was fermented in small open-top vessels with hand punch downs daily.
  • Aging: 18 months in 20% new French Oak
  • Tasting Note: The 2022 vintage starts with deeply pitched floral notes and follows with flavors of dark macerated blackberry, wild strawberry, and warm spice characteristics. This is kept quite lively by accents of Northern California forest pine needles and focused acidity. The wine was bottled unfined and unfiltered.
  • Scores: 90 Points, Vinous The 2022 Pinot Noir (Sonoma County) is terrific. It offers gorgeous depth and fine balance. Succulent red cherry, plum, spice, rose petal and cedar are nicely pushed forward. This shows a good combination of forward fruit with an extra kick of richness from the 25% new oak—pretty much unheard of for a wine at this level.
